What is cc of liquid? A cubic centimetre (or cubic centimeter in US English) (SI unit symbol: cm3; non-SI abbreviations: cc and ccm) is a commonly used unit of volume that corresponds to the volume of a cube that measures 1 cm × 1 cm × 1 cm. One cubic centimetre corresponds to a volume of one millilitre.
Is a cc and a mL the same? What’s the difference between a cubic centimeter (cc) and milliliter (mL)? These are the same measurement; there is no difference in volume. When to add liquid yeast to beer?
Liquid yeast can be added directly to the wort once the wort cools to a temperature below 80° F. You may decide to do a yeast starter, which is recommended for high gravity/alcohol beers.

Can you use front loader liquid detergent in top loader?
There isn’t necessarily harm in using high-efficiency front-loader detergent in a top-load washing machine. You might need to add more detergent, however, and some of the suds may be wasted in higher levels of water in the drum.

How much liquid detergent in front loader?
If you are adding the detergent yourself for each load, use no more than one tablespoon of HE detergent. If the product is 2x concentrate use two teaspoons or 3x concentrate use one teaspoon. The same rule applies to fabric softener and bleach.

Is water in clouds liquid or gas?
The water that makes up clouds is in liquid or ice form. The air around us is partially made up of invisible water vapor. It’s only when that water vapor cools and condenses into liquid water droplets or solid ice crystals that visible clouds form.
What is the liquid that comes out of wounds?
If the drainage is thin and clear, it’s serum, also known as serous fluid. This is typical when the wound is healing, but the inflammation around the injury is still high. A small amount of serous drainage is normal.
Why mercury is a liquid metal?
Mercury is the only metal that is liquid at standard conditions for temperature and pressure. … Mercury has a unique electron configuration which strongly resists removal of an electron, making it behave similarly to noble gas elements. As a result, mercury forms weak bonds and is a liquid at room temperature.

What property holds water molecules together in the liquid state?
Water has an amazing ability to adhere (stick) to itself and to other substances. The property of cohesion describes the ability of water molecules to be attracted to other water molecules, which allows water to be a “sticky” liquid.
